Square Enix Announces 'Final Fantasy XVI'

Debuting its ‘Awakening’ trailer.

Along with the volley of announcements on the PlayStation 5 from Sony, Square Enix has now announced the latest installment for its legendary Final Fantasy franchise, simply named Final Fantasy XVI, dropping a reveal trailer at the same time.

The four-minute clip — which you can watch above — gives fans a first look at a wide range of the game’s features, combining cinematic cutscenes with gameplay captures. While the story hasn’t been officially revealed by the Japanese developer, the trailer suggests a medieval fantasy setting with the usual Final Fantasy hallmarks, such as summons and crystals. You’ll also be introduced to a few of the game’s main characters, including a child named Joshua, who is revealed to possess the power of the Phoenix, as well as his protector, which will be the role players will take on.

“The exclusive footage, comprised of both battles and cutscenes running in real-time, represents but a fraction of what our team has accomplished since the start of development on this, an all-new Final Fantasy game,” says the game’s producer  Naoki Yoshida. “In that span, the team’s size has grown from a handful of core members to a full-fledged unit that continues to polish and build upon what they have created so far, all to provide players an experience unmatched in terms of story and gameplay.”

There’s currently no information regarding a release date, with the title’s director Hiroshi Takai saying that “it may still be some time before we can get it into your hands,” so Final Fantasy fans should definitely stay tuned for more updates to come.
